27 * This class encapsulates "magic words" such as "#redirect", __NOTOC__, etc.
31 * if (MagicWord::get( 'redirect' )->match( $text ) ) {
36 * Possible future improvements:
37 * * Simultaneous searching for a number of magic words
38 * * MagicWord::$mObjects in shared memory
40 * Please avoid reading the data out of one of these objects and then writing
41 * special case code. If possible, add another match()-like function here.
43 * To add magic words in an extension, use $magicWords in a file listed in
44 * $wgExtensionMessagesFiles[].
48 * $magicWords = array();
50 * $magicWords['en'] = array(
51 * 'magicwordkey' => array( 0, 'case_insensitive_magic_word' ),
52 * 'magicwordkey2' => array( 1, 'CASE_sensitive_magic_word2' ),
56 * For magic words which are also Parser variables, add a MagicWordwgVariableIDs
57 * hook. Use string keys.
